I have a mix of both Transmetals and Japanese Metals TF's and most of them are pretty much the same. I would say Metals is better, but not worth spending the extra cash if you dont have too. The only exception I would make is Rampage and Silverbolt which are hands down better then their Hasbro counterparts. Most of the Metals have slightly different paint apps then the TM's such as Rhinox and Airrazor but nothing to make you want to bend over backwards just to get the Metals versions of them. But ya if your going for these guys I would say the Metals Rampage and Silverbolt are the only Metals ones worth tracking down as they flat out kick the crap out of the Hasbro versions (and they come in a 2 pack as well ). As for the rest, the differences are negligible at best between most of them, but the Metals also have better packaging if your into that sort of thing.
Optimus and Megs are FAR FAR FAR better than Hasbro's. Optimus purple parts are a deep translucent plastic, looks really nice.
